Healthy Eats at Jack-In-The-Box

Breakfast:

jbox box 150x136 Healthy Eats at Jack In The Box  Breakfast Jack (Cheese, Ham, and Eggs): 287 calories, 12g fat

* Yes low in calories, but extremely high in fat

Any other breakfast sandwich has up to 500-600 calories in each one and the burritos add up to about 800 calories.

The Steak and Egg burrito has a whopping 806 calories with 49g of fat!

The Denver breakfast bowl that looks somewhat healthy with veggies has a grand total of 720 calories with 53g of fat… holy cow that is a lot of fat!

banner 150x150 Healthy Eats at Jack In The Box  Hamburgers:

Kids Cheeseburger: 317 calories, 14g fat

The Hamburger Deluxe without the mayo: 280 calories, 11g fat

Avoid all other hamburgers! You won’t find anything under 600 calories. Just three of these small mini sirloin burgers has a whopping 748 calories with 29g of fat!

Chicken:

CIMG1672 150x150 Healthy Eats at Jack In The Box  Grilled Chicken Strips (4pc): 177 calories, 2g fat

Chicken Fajita Pita without cheese: 236 calories, 3g fat

* Both of these are my all time favorites… not only because they are low in calorie and fat but because they taste so good. I love the sautéed bell peppers and onions on the Pita!

All other chicken sandwiches have up to 700-600 calories

JiB TeriyakiBowls 150x150 Healthy Eats at Jack In The Box  Teriyaki Bowls

Chicken Bowl without the sauce: 584 calories, 6g of fat

* Not the lowest of calories but at least you aren’t getting all that fat!

Salads:

Asian Grilled Chicken Salad without dressing, wontons, or almonds: 177 calories, 1g of fat

… add those I didn’t and you pack on another 404 calories and 29 g of fat to total 581 calories and 30g of fat… a difference a small change can make in a salad!

Southwestern Grilled Chicken Salad without dressing, cheese, and corn strips: 209 calories, 2g fat

Side Salad without croutons: 52 calories 3g of fat

* It’s amazing what a few changes on your salad can make! Before ordering your salad go through the menu and mark down all the things you don’t want on your salad before you order!

Sides:

big 230 150x150 Healthy Eats at Jack In The Box  Beef Taco: 157 calories, 8g fat

Grilled Chicken Pita Snack without sauce or cheese: 187 calories, 2g fat

Fish Pita Snack without sauce or cheese: 256 calories, 8g fat

Steak Pita Snack without sauce or cheese: 224 calories, 5g fat

* The sauce and cheese on these snack pitas add another 123 calories and a 12g of fat!!

Small kids fries: 209 calories, 11g fat

Applesauce: 100 calories

JackintheBox smoothies 150x150 Healthy Eats at Jack In The Box  Drinks:

Strawberry Banana Smoothie: 295 calories, 56g sugar

Mango Smoothie: 289 calories, 57g sugar

Pomegranate Blueberry Smoothie: 277 calories, 53g sugar

. . . is these smoothies don’t give you a sugar high than I don’t know what will!!! Avoid these due to all that sugar!

Flavored Teas: 83 calories, 19g sugar

16oz Iced Vanilla Coffee: 98 calories, 16g sugar

16oz Caramel Iced Coffee: 94 calories, 15g sugar

16oz Original Coffee: 96 calories, 16g sugar
